Ligger – An individual who attends parties, openings, social gatherings and events with the sole intention of obtaining free food and drink – an arch blagger, or bludger. A new word created by combining portions of two existing words is called a portmanteau, and they are very popular as a way to give a new name to a celebrity couple.For example, the actors Brad Pitt and Angelina Jolie were known as "Brangelina" when they were married. Bloke is simply a British slang term for 'man/guy', with perhaps slight connotations of masculinity, and used only in an informal setting. In modern day millennial slang, English speakers might literally say the works “jk” as in “just kidding.” Adding that to the end of any sentence is a great way to let people know you’re just joking around.
